Cometic 4.380 head gaskets
 
I'm looking for some .060 head gaskets, but haven't found a set in stock. Anyone know of any shops that may have some in stock?

My current head gaskets appear to be in excellent physical condition, other than slight combustion seepage (about 3/8" wide) between the center cylinders.

If I can't find new gaskets, is it possible to copper spray and reuse the old gaskets?

The block deck looks great and the heads are freshly surfaced.

What heads are you running?
If they have paired center exh ports it’s a good thing if your running head bolts to take the center two up to 100 ft lbs.

If your running Aluminium heads there deck finish needs to be near mirror like for the best gasket longevity.

Mean Green 07-20-2021 06:45 PM

High port heads. Block and heads are machined for MLS head gaskets.

I wouldn't have an issue reusing the head gaskets, if I was running NA. But this engine is going to be sprayed with a healthy shot of N2O.
